Naples Origins Explored Inside the Cradle of Pizza Culture

Naples, a vibrant city perched on Italy’s southwestern coast, is widely regarded as the birthplace of pizza-a culinary tradition that has captivated taste buds worldwide. The origins of this iconic dish trace back to the late 18th century, when impoverished Neapolitans began topping flatbreads with simple ingredients like tomatoes, mozzarella, and fresh basil-a combination now immortalized as the classic Margherita. Beyond its culinary significance, Naples offers a rich tapestry of cultural history that shaped the authenticity of pizza, blending ancient trade influences and local ingredients that made it a food staple for both peasants and aristocrats alike.

Inside the cradle of pizza culture, visitors can explore:

  • Historic Pizzerias: Original establishments like Antica Pizzeria Port’Alba, dating back to 1830, still serve pies made with traditional methods.
  • Artisan Markets: Vibrant food markets where fresh, regional ingredients-such as buffalo mozzarella and San Marzano tomatoes-are handpicked daily.
  • Pizza Museums: Institutions dedicated to preserving the dish’s heritage and showcasing its evolution through centuries of Neapolitan history.

Must Visit Pizzerias Where Tradition Meets Authentic Flavor

In the heart of this historic city, pizzerias are more than just eateries-they are living museums where centuries-old recipes come to life. Each oven, often wood-fired and bursting with heat, preserves the essence of tradition, delivering pies that are both simple and sublime. These establishments pride themselves on using authentic ingredients like San Marzano tomatoes and fresh buffalo mozzarella, ensuring every bite is bursting with genuine Italian flavor. Locals and travelers alike flock to renowned spots such as Antica Pizzeria da Michele and Pizzeria Sorbillo, where the craftsmanship of pizza-making is treated as a cherished art form.

For those seeking a tactile guide to the city’s pizzeria landscape, the following list highlights key venues renowned for their historical significance and unmatched taste profiles:

  • Antica Pizzeria da Michele – Known as the “Temple of Pizza,” serving just two classic varieties.
  • Pizzeria Sorbillo – A family-run establishment famed for its vibrant atmosphere and innovative toppings.
  • Di Matteo – Where street food culture meets time-honored pizza craftsmanship.
  • Pizzeria Starita – A pioneer in combining traditional recipes with modern flair.
